Cowboys death
Sun Dec 09, 2012 | Comment

josh breant at the irving police departementCowboys death, arrest serve as another sad reminder that DUIs are a major problem for NFL

For the second consecutive week, the NFL was broadsided with a tragedy – a preventable, painful tragedy.

On Saturday, Dallas Cowboys nose tackle Josh Brent was charged with intoxication manslaughter after what Irving, Texas, police described as a high-speed early morning crash on State Highway 114 that caused his car to flip at least once before winding up on a service road.

FRESNO, Calif — Deep in the Sierra Nevada, the famous General Grant giant sequoia tree is suffering its loss of stature in silence. What once was the world's No. 2 biggest tree has been supplanted thanks to the most comprehensive measurements taken of the largest living things on Earth.

The new No. 2 is The President, a 54,000-cubic-foot gargantuan not far from the Grant in Sequoia National Park. After 3,240 years, the giant sequoia still is growing wider at a consistent rate, which may be what most surprised the scientists examining how the sequoias and coastal redwoods will be affected by climate change and whether these trees have a role to play in combatting it.

Moving to Bali: What to bring with you
Sun Nov 25, 2012 | Comment

 

Books

Children’s books are difficult to obtain in Bali. There is a chain of bookstores (Periplus) that have a limited supply of children’s books but they tend to be for very young children. Books for pre-teens and teens are hard to find although there been a definite improvement in their range of teen books over the last 6-12 months. Ganesha bookstore in Ubud and Seminyak also has a range of books although very few children’s books. There is a library in Ubud and a number of second hand bookstores in most tourist areas where you can buy and sell books. There is a bookstore specifically for children in Seminyak called Enchanted Books. They have a small range of books for older children and teens and a large range for young children. Luwak or animal coffee
Sat Nov 24, 2012 | Comment

The origin of the Kopi Luwak is closely related to the history of coffee cultivation in Indonesia. At the beginning of the 18th century, the Dutch opened the commercial plantation colonies in the East Indies, especially in Java and Sumatra. One is the Arabica coffee seedlings imported from Yemen.
